“…While in [20], the effect of the Downlink and Uplink message size on round trip time has been experimentally shown. This effect is treated with and without forwarding Error Correction (FEC) between a Supervisory Control and Data Acquisition (SCADA) center and a destination RTU (Remote Terminal Units).…”
